Lantern Gateway is a artwork in Washington, at a modelled 113 m. Rattlesnake Mountain - West Peak stands 994 m to the east-southeast, 25 miles off. The nearest named place is Skyline Canopies, a artwork less than a tenth of a mile away. Mountains to Sound Greenway - I-90 passes 1.9 miles off. 51 named summits stand within 25 miles.
Two columns topped with cube-shaped glass fixtures with steel plates perforated in a house pattern, a pair of notched cantilevered cedar glulam beams support a plexiglas and perforated aluminum roof panel.
